2013-08-12 15 views
8

Tôi là một lập trình viên C# với một số kinh nghiệm C++, tất cả trên Windows.Làm thế nào để lập trình Intel Xeon Phi với C#?

Với bộ kỹ năng này, có bất kỳ tùy chọn nào để phát triển cho bộ xử lý Intel Xeon Phi không?

Tìm thấy điều này link, nhưng không chắc chắn nếu đó là cách tốt nhất/duy nhất.

Cảm ơn lời khuyên của bạn.

+1

Rất nhiệt tình! Bạn muốn phát triển những gì bạn cần trợ giúp ở đây? – Nayan

+0

Tính toán và lập mô hình tài chính. – user1044169

+0

Câu hỏi của bạn cần một bài đăng trên blog. – Nayan

Trả lời

4

Khám phá An Overview of Programming for Intel® Xeon® processors and Intel® Xeon Phi coprocessors để biết thông tin tổng quan.

Từ phần:

biên dịch và lập trình mô hình

Có một số khuyến nghị chúng ta có thể thực hiện dựa trên những gì đã làm việc tốt cho các nhà phát triển. Đối với các lập trình viên của Fortran, sử dụng OpenMP, DO CONCURRENT và MPI. Đối với các lập trình viên C++, sử dụng Intel TBB, Intel Cilk Plus và OpenMP. Đối với các lập trình viên C, sử dụng OpenMP và Intel Cilk Plus.

Cũng từ cùng một nguồn:

đọc bổ sung

tài liệu bổ sung liên quan đến lập trình cho coprocessors Intel Xeon Phi có thể được tìm thấy tại http://intel.com/software/mic.

Một cuốn sách mới có tựa đề “Intel® Xeon PhiTM coprocessor High Performance Lập trình, Tập 1: Essentials” bởi Jim Jeffers và James Reinders, © 2013, xuất bản bởi Intel Press, dự kiến ​​sẽ có mặt vào đầu năm 2013.

Các vấn đề liên quan